RE: .410 for deer
Using a 410 is illegal in Iowa, too...so you know. I think the smallest bore for deer in Iowa is 28 guage, but it might be 20 guage, not sure. No rifles allowed, except muzzleloaders .45 cal or bigger. .357 caliber and up pistols are now allowed too during any gun season except early muzzleloader. When in doubt, check the game laws.

RE: .410 for deer
A 410 only shoots a 87 grain slug. As opposed to a 437 grain 12 gauge slug. I would't want to risk it.
